SHIFNAL TOWN 3 WHITCHURCH ALPORT 1 Midland Football League, Premier Division Saturday 2 April 2022

 SHIFNAL TOWN 3  WHITCHURCH ALPORT 1 

Midland Football League, Premier Division

Saturday 2 April 2022

 

Both sides had trouble with control on a bonehard playing surface, but ultimately it was the home side that adapted better, and avenged a defeat at Whitchurch earlier in the season. The first chance of the game fell to the visitors after 5 minutes, Alex Hughes’ low shot from just outside the penalty area passing the wrong side of the upright. Ashley Brown came close for Shifnal in the 17th minute with a 25-yard free-kick which was inches wide. Town opened the scoring on 26 minutes, JEREMY ABBEY heading home Jack Fishman’s cross from the right. Hughes again looked dangerous, and Town were pleased to see his 12-yard strike in the 34th minute deflect off Sean Jones for a corner. 3 minutes before the break, Abbey played the ball through for Andre Brown, but his angled effort was wide of the far post.

 

The hosts doubled their lead after 56 minutes, when Fishman’s corner was headed goalwards by Andre Brown. The ball was blocked, but SAM GRIFFITHS latched on to the loose ball and drove into the roof of the net from close range. Tyrone Ofori and Andre Brown had further chances before Town made the game safe with a third goal on 72 minutes. A ball in from the left picked out Liam Palmer, who played it forward to DAVE EASTHOPE with his back to goal. He took a couple of touches before rolling the ball into the bottom corner from 10 yards. Alport substitute Joe Flory came into his own in the final quarter of an hour, causing a few problems to the Shifnal defence. A defensive slip in the 80th minute let FLORY in, and after running 25 yards, he chipped Andy Wycherley from the edge of the penalty area, to the delight of the visitors’ fans. Shortly afterwards, following good play on the left, a cross was chested down for Flory, but his 18-yard shot was saved comfortably by Wycherley.
